Akash Gajjar 4676e59d3d disp: msm: sde: assign a non-pairable DSC to a topology that requires single DSC
During suspend-resume in a dual-display scenario with primary
display topology <2 2 1> and secondary display topology <1 1 1>
with 3 DSC instances, allocating DSC block 1 to the secondary
display results in DSC blocks 2 and 3 being assigned to the
primary display. However, as DSC block 2 is not a peer of DSC
block 3, it triggers an atomic check failure as a part of the RM
reservation failure. While reserving the DSC resources, prefer non
pairable DSC if the topology requests for single DSC instance. If
there are no non pairable DSCs available, then select one of the
available DSC.
